Transliteration

Zaalikal Kitaabu laa raiba feeh; udal lilmuttaqeen

Translation

This is the Book about which there is no doubt, a guidance for those conscious of Allah -

Verse interpretation (Tafsir)

This is the Qur’ān, in which there is nothing of any doubt, neither in terms of its origin, nor in terms of its meaning. It is the word of Allah, guiding those who are mindful of Allah to the way that leads to Him.

Source: Al-Mukhtasar Tafsir — Tafsir Center for Quranic Studies.
